: The downloading order isn't critical, but the installation order is. RSLogix 500 and RSLogix Emulate 500 depend on RSLinx Classic. Therefore, install RSLinx Classic Lite first, followed by the FactoryTalk Services Platform, and finally RSLogix 500 itself. rslogix 500 download programming software

You cannot buy directly from Rockwell as an end user. Contact an authorized Allen‑Bradley distributor (e.g., Rexel, Graybar, Radwell). Expect to pay depending on edition and activation type (Node‑locked vs Concurrent).
